What You Will Do
Modeling and laboratory experiments related to the long-term storage of high-level nuclear waste in a salt repository;
Low-Density plasma modeling utilizing Maxwellian and non-Maxwellian electron energy distributions;
Application of fluid dynamics modeling techniques to develop and refine simulations for physical systems such as stars, planets, Earth's climate, as well as engineered systems;
Ultrafast optical experiments involving quantum materials;
Using uncertainty quantification methods to improve full-scale models of new carbon capture technologies;
Modeling neutron scattering and yield within systems involving extreme temperature and pressure conditions;
Theoretical studies and modeling of actinide chemistry under a variety of physical conditions; and
Using neutrinos and neutrons to probe the fundamental laws that govern the evolution of the universe.

Where You Will Work
Located in Northern New Mexico, Los Alamos National Laboratory (LANL) is a multidisciplinary research institution engaged in strategic science on behalf of national security. LANL enhances national security by ensuring the safety and reliability of the U.S. nuclear stockpile, developing technologies to reduce threats from weapons of mass destruction, and solving problems related to energy, environment, infrastructure, health, and global security concerns.
